Output 903489b23d7c6e767ec8684a6781d170cf7cf0631fe0e8aa3fdd1a0a9f2254c1:1

value
27148360
script pubkey
OP_0 OP_PUSHBYTES_20 f2aecd6ab28d970ee8eea34665c181393b8754c6
address
bc1q72hv664j3ktsa68w5drxtsvp8yacw4xxt7rvxm
transaction
903489b23d7c6e767ec8684a6781d170cf7cf0631fe0e8aa3fdd1a0a9f2254c1
spent
true